DY-SK-D2-2.0RH Full Automatic Leather Punching Machine

The DY-SK-D2-2.0RH Full Automatic Leather Punching Machine is designed for precise leather punching work using a high-speed multi-axis CNC punching system. Built for controlled pattern execution, punching accuracy, and flexible hole configuration, this machine combines CNC-based punching control with servo-driven motion and multi-head tooling for production-oriented leather processing.

One of the key strengths of this model is its ability to install six specifications of punching needles at the same time. Each punch can be rotated to create 360-degree punching patterns by changing the angle of each punch through computer software such as AUTOCAD and CORELDRAW. This makes the DY-SK-D2-2.0RH suitable for punching work where pattern flexibility and repeatable precision are important.

The machine also uses a servo motor for the main axis and driving system, while the X/Y axes adopt screw direct drive mode for high punching accuracy. Along with an industrial dust collector and a machine layout that can be designed according to specific requirements, the DY-SK-D2-2.0RH is positioned as a professional leather punching solution with both technical control and production practicality.

Machine Overview

The DY-SK-D2-2.0RH is identified as a Full Automatic Leather Punching Machine. The machine is built around a High-Speed Multi-Axis CNC Punching System, combining automatic punching performance with controlled pattern handling.

This model is designed for punching work where multiple tool sizes, rotation control, and consistent motion accuracy are required. The machine’s working speed, working area, tool-head arrangement, and drive system all support this positioning.

With a working speed of 1300 rpm, working area of 900 × 600 mm, and 12 tool heads arranged as 6 in each group, the machine is configured for organized multi-tool punching work within a defined CNC punching area.

High-Speed Multi-Axis CNC Punching System

At the center of the DY-SK-D2-2.0RH is its high-speed multi-axis CNC punching system. This system supports the machine’s automatic punching capability and gives it the ability to handle patterned punching work with more controlled movement and repeatability.

The machine adopts the unique multi-axis CNC system of “Jinyuelai”, and one of its practical advantages is that six specifications of punching needles can be installed at the same time. This allows multiple round-hole sizes to remain available within the machine setup, reducing the need to limit punching work to a single tool size.

Because the machine is CNC-based, it is suited to operations where the hole arrangement and pattern layout need to follow a digital path rather than a manually repeated process.

Pattern Flexibility and Rotating Punch Control

A major functional feature of the DY-SK-D2-2.0RH is its ability to rotate each punch. This allows the machine to create 360-degree patterns by changing the angle of each punch through computer-based design control.

The machine works with AUTOCAD and CORELDRAW, which are specifically named as the software used to control punch angle and pattern direction. This gives the machine a more flexible punching character, especially for decorative layouts and fancy punching patterns.

In addition to this, each set of punch heads can be rotated to achieve fancy punching. This means the machine is not limited to simple fixed punching repetition. Instead, its setup is aimed at patterned punching where angle and layout play an active role in the finished result.

Drive System and Punching Accuracy

The DY-SK-D2-2.0RH uses a servo motor for the main axis and driving system. This helps support stable performance in automatic punching operation.

For movement accuracy, the X/Y axes adopt screw direct drive mode. This is an important technical detail because the machine directly links axis movement to punching accuracy. In practical terms, this part of the machine structure supports more controlled head movement across the working area.

Together, the servo-driven main axis and screw direct drive mode define the machine as a controlled punching platform rather than a basic manual punching unit.

Tooling Configuration and Working Setup

The machine is configured with 12 tool heads, listed as 6 in each group. This tool-head setup works together with the multi-axis CNC system and six simultaneous punching needle specifications.

The standard punching tool range is listed as round hole sizes 0.8 mm, 1.0 mm, 1.2 mm, 1.5 mm, 2.0 mm and 2.5 mm. This gives the machine a clear working range for standard round-hole punching.

The machine also includes a maximum storage capacity of 256M, showing that digital pattern handling and storage are part of the machine’s operating setup.

With a working area of 900 × 600 mm, the DY-SK-D2-2.0RH provides a defined punching zone suitable for controlled layout execution inside the CNC working range.

Dust Collection and Machine Customization

The machine adopts an industrial dust collector, giving it a good dust collection effect. This is a practical part of the overall machine setup, especially in punching work where fine punching waste needs to be managed around the work area.

Another notable point is that the machine and operating system can be designed according to specific requirements. This adds flexibility to the machine’s positioning and suggests that the setup can be aligned with particular production or operating needs.

Technical Specifications

Model DY-SK-D2-2.0RH
Machine Type Full Automatic Leather Punching Machine
System Type High-Speed Multi-Axis CNC Punching System
Working Speed 1300 rpm
Maximum Storage Capacity 256M
Power 2–3KW
Power Supply 220V Single-phase 220V
Air Pressure 0.6Mpa
Punching Tool No. Standard round hole (0.8, 1.0, 1.2, 1.5, 2.0, 2.5mm)
Number of Tool Heads 12 (6 in each group)
Working Area 900 × 600 mm
Machine Size 3565 × 1480 × 1380 mm
Net Weight 1200KG
